Q: Is 4,426,684 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 4,426,684 is not a prime number.

Why is 4,426,684 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 4426684 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 1,106,671 2,213,342 and 4,426,684, with no remainder.

Since 4,426,684 cannot be divided by just 1 and 4,426,684, it is not a prime number.
